I got myself an HTC Incredible from Verizon last year. Roughly 30 days was about all I could tolerate of the stock software it came with. Verizon (and the other carriers from what I gather), love to plant their mostly worthless software onto your phone right from the get go, which proves to only slow your device down, which in my case was only further compounded by the slowdown that the Sense UI caused. Yeah it looks nice, and it does sort your contacts from multiple services in an idiot-proofed kind of way, but I found it to be more cumbersome than anything. Read more »

And for your mid-day post while I wait for an installation to finish.  Pointless gadgets sometime fascinate me and this one is no exception.  Gizmodo has an interesting article about a device from Genius called a “Ring Presenter”.  This device fits on your finger and allows you to control your mouse by using your thumb.  Basically, you would use the cursor pad in the center to control the mouse and use the 4 buttons to control your Powerpoint presentations.  When not using Powerpoint, the device essentially functions as a mouse.
